MUSIC OF THE ROMANTIC
PERIOD
Romanticism, commonly referred to as
Romantic era (Romantic period) was an
artistic, literary, musical, and intellectual
movement that originated in Europe
towards the end of the 18th century.
MUSIC OF THE ROMANTIC
PERIOD
Romantic composers saw music as a way
of individual and emotional expression. They
considered music the art form most capable
of expressing the full range of human
emotion.
MUSIC OF THE ROMANTIC
PERIOD
The importance the Romantics placed on
emotion is summed up in the remark of the
German painter Caspar David Friedrich,
"the artist's feeling is his law".
Ludwig Van Beethoven
 Was the originator of bridging the
music from Classical to Romantic
Era by expressing his passion and
emotions through his music.
 He lived and worked during the
transition from the Classical to the
Romantic Period and was an
inspiration to the Romantic
composers who came after him.
The Characteristics of Romantic
Music
 has freedom in form and design; more personal
and emotional.
 song-like melodies (lyrical), as well as many
chromatic harmonies and discords.
 dramatic contrasts of dynamics and pitch.
 big orchestras, due mainly to brass and the
invention of the valve.
 wide variety of pieces (i.e. songs up to five hour
Wagner operas)
 program music (music that tells a story)
 shape was brought to work through the use of
recurring themes.
 great technical virtuosity
 nationalism (a reaction against German influence)

Niccolo Paganini
 The most famous violin virtuoso in the
world is Niccolo Paganini.
 His fame came the rumors about his
amazing violin skills that was said to be a
gift from the devil and that he sold his
soul in exchange for those skills.
 Some works of Niccolo Paganini:
● “La Campanella”
● 24 Caprices for Solo Violin, Op.1
● Concerto no.1 in Eb, Op.6
● 15 Quartets for Guitar and Strings Trio
● “The Carnival of Venice”

PIANO
MUSIC
Piano music of the Romantic Period was filled
with innovations. Most of the compositions
require a high level of virtuosity. Some were
reinventions of sonatas from the Classical era.

Frederic Chopin
 Known as the “Poet of the Piano”. Most
of his music was influenced by folk music.
 Chopin composed almost primarily for the
piano and some of his most well- known
compositions are Fantasie in F minor,
Op.49, Revolutionary Etude, Op.10,
No.12 and 24 Preludes,Op.28

Frederic Chopin
Chopin is famous for the following:
 Ballade – a verse form or narrative that is set
to music
 Etude – a piece composed for the
development of a specific technique
 Mazurka – a Polish dance in triple time
signature
 Nocturne – an instrumental composition of a
pensive, dreamy mood, for the piano
 Polonaise – a slow Polish dance in triple time
that consists of a march or procession
 Prelude – a short piece of music that can be
used as a preface, and introduction to another
work or may stand on its own.

Frederic Chopin
Chopin is famous for the following:
 Waltz – a German dance in triple meter
 Impromptu – a short free-form musical
composition usually for a solo instrument,
like the piano
 Scherzo – a musical movement of playful
character, typically in ABA form

Franz Liszt
 He was known as the virtuoso pianist, a
composer and the busiest musician during
Romantic.
 The best word known that describes the
works of Franz Liszt is “virtuosity”
 He was also known for his symphonic
poems where he translated great literacy
works into musical compositions. He
made also made piano transcriptions
of operas and famous symphonies.
Many of his piano compositions are
technically challenging pieces.

Robert
Schumann
 One of the famous Romantic
composers that beautifully combined
music and words. A composer and music
critic.
 He spent most of his time with musical
and literacy circles through the effort of
Friedrich Wieck who took some time to
teach Schumann how to play the piano.
 It was the time when he wrote some of his
first piano compositions.
 It was 1834 when Schumann founded the
music journal, “Jornal Neue Zeitschrift
fur Musik” wherein edited and wrote
music criticism for his publication.

PROGRAM
MUSIC
Program music is an instrumental composition
that conveys images or scenes to tell a short
story without text or lyrics.It entices the
imagination of the listener.
